Potluck on the Pedernales: The Community Garden Club of Johnson City
Potluck on the Pedernales: The Community Garden Club of Johnson City features down home cooking from deep in the heart of LBJ Country. This regional winner of the Tabasco Community Cookbook Awards in 1991 is a wonderful cookbook with delicious contry dishes.

Description: The Community Garden Club of Johnson City is very proud to publish a book such as this that contains recipes, folklore, and is presented in an amusing and informative way. This is a true LBJ Country cookbook of Pedernales Pot Luck from the people who made the history here so unique and the food so great. Enjoy!
One of my favorite times of the year in the Hill Country is spring, slipping into early summer, while it's still pleasantly cool outside...Toward sunset we gather for a casual dinner in the front yard. The buffet tables are covered with patch-work quilts, topped by centerpieces of wildflowers gathered nearby. On the serving tables homemade jams, jellies and relishes surround a "country spread" of fried chicken, ham, black-eyed peas, pickled okra, garden vegetable salad, and scalloped potatoes... We pass baskets of hot biscuits after guests are seated, and as is the custom, are invited to select for themselves... There is usually a good old-fashioned buttermilk pie -- reflecting pioneer frugality and which is still a favorite down through the many years.
